With 2 goals and a assist today, Matsumoto has been great in the AHL. He has not only been putting up points, but his +/- has been fantastic. If he keeps this up, I think the Flyers will have to call him up.

Also, the flyers 7th round draft pick from 2006, Andrei Popov, is apparently ripping it up in the KHL.

Sort of exciting that the flyers have these under the radar prospects who seem to be developing into pretty good players.
